Graveside services for Robert E. (Bob) White were held Thursday, Feb. 24, 2011 at 3 p.m. from Eastlawn Cemetery in Philadelphia with Steve Mabry officiating. McClain-Hays Funeral Home was charge of arrangements.
Mr. White, 88, of Philadelphia, died Tuesday, February 22, 2011 at Neshoba County General Hospital.
He was a native of Union City, Tenn. and a longtime resident of Starkville. He had made his home in Philadelphia for the past seven years. He operated White Aircraft Maintenance & Service and was manager of the Starkville Airport for several years until retirement. Mr. White was a member of the Church of Christ in Philadelphia. He was a former member of Starkville Exchange Club. He served in the U.S. Navy during World War II.
Survivors include his wife of 68 years, Mary Virginia White of Philadelphia; daughters, Barbara Booker of Philadelphia and Judith Cole of Corpus Christi, Texas; three grandchildren, Thomas Booker of Philadelphia, Bryan Booker of Brandon, and Lesley Hedlund of Easton, Penn.; six great-grandchildren, Jonathan Booker, Taylor Booker, Mary Ellen Booker, Emily Booker, Camilla Hedlund, and Kira Hedlund; sister, Betty Hill of Troy, Tenn. and several nieces and nephews.
